Ried is situated in the middle of the Oberen Gericht region, in the most western part of the Oberinntal. The road from the Sonnenplateau (Serfaus, Fiss, Ladis) and the Reschenstraße Road merge together and make Ried an important traffic junction. The name "Ried" means boggy land. Excavations from the Bronze and Roman period clearly indicate that the area has long been settled. Ried was first mentioned in a document in the 12th century. Before the circuit court was established in the district capital Landeck in the late 20th century, it had been in Castle Sigmundsried since the 17th century.
